The Moat That Only Gets Deeper

A professional voice built over years is not replicable from training data. It is the product of specific professional experiences, in specific markets, shaped by a specific combination of cultural contexts and intellectual influences.

Maya's bicultural frame cannot be produced by a model trained on internet content. It can only come from 34 years of living across two professional cultures, building expertise at the intersection that most consultants have to choose between.

That is the moat. Not the fact that she knows things. Knowing things is cheap now — cheaper than it has ever been. The moat is that she knows things in a specific way, shaped by a specific path, expressible only in a specific voice.

The risk was never that AI could replicate that. The risk was that the tools she used to produce content would erase it in the output — would take what she actually knows and render it in the generic professional register that has no memory of where she came from.

That risk was real. It happened. The moat is intact. The output was not.
